Key Features to Look for in an Ergonomic Office Chair

When choosing a work from home chair, several features can enhance your comfort and support. Here are some essentials:

  • Lumbar Support: A chair with built-in lumbar support helps maintain the natural curve of your spine, reducing the risk of back pain.
  • Seat Depth and Width: Ensure that the seat is deep and wide enough to accommodate your body comfortably. Your feet should rest flat on the floor.
  • Adjustable Armrests: Armrests that can be adjusted in height and width help reduce strain on your shoulders and neck.
  • Swivel Base: A chair that swivels allows you to easily reach different areas of your workspace without straining.
  • Mobility: Consider chairs with wheels for easy movement around your office.

Choosing the Right Materials

The materials used in your chair can impact both comfort and durability. Here are some common materials you might encounter:

  • Mesh: Mesh chairs are popular for their breathability and lightness. They keep you cool during long work hours.
  • Fabric: Fabric chairs offer warmth and comfort. Look for high-quality upholstery that can withstand wear and tear.
  • Leather: Leather chairs exude a professional appearance. They are easy to clean but may not be as breathable as fabric or mesh options.

Finding the Right Fit for Your Home Office Setup

Your home office setup should promote productivity and well-being. Here are some tips to integrate your chair into your workspace:

  • Desk Height: Ensure your desk is at an appropriate height for your chair. Your elbows should be at a 90-degree angle when typing.
  • Monitor Position: Your monitor should be at eye level to prevent neck strain. Position it about an arm’s length away.
  • Lighting: Good lighting reduces eye strain. Position your chair so that natural light comes from the side, avoiding glare on your screen.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What is the best height for a work from home chair?

The best height for a work from home chair allows your feet to rest flat on the floor, with your knees at a 90-degree angle. Most chairs have adjustable heights to accommodate different users.

2. How do I know if my chair is ergonomic?

An ergonomic chair generally has adjustable features, lumbar support, and promotes a healthy posture. If you can adjust the height, armrests, and lumbar support to fit your body, it is likely ergonomic.

5. How often should I replace my office chair?

Most office chairs last between 5 to 10 years, depending on usage and quality. If you notice signs of wear or discomfort, it might be time to consider a replacement.
